What Engence builds

Production AI agents with controls around the model.

The model is only one part of the system. The production work includes data paths, integrations, evaluation, monitoring, and the human decisions around automation.

Workflow automation with human-in-the-loop checkpoints

Secure tool integrations across CRMs, support desks, internal systems, and knowledge bases

Evaluation harnesses, permissioning, logs, and production monitoring

Questions

Common questions about AI agents.

Do AI agents run fully autonomously?

Only where the risk profile supports it. Most production agents start with explicit permissions, review states, and audit logs before broader automation.

Can agents run inside our environment and connect to existing tools?

Yes. We design around secure tool access, context retrieval, action boundaries, deployment constraints, and reliable fallbacks inside the client's environment.
